Great smoker but poor internal sizing
I have to give this four stars for one reason: poorly thought out internal sizing. The cooking industry uses full, half, and quarter-sized sheet pans as a standard for sizing. The internal racks of this unit are 15"x12". A half sheet pan is 18"x13" and a quarter-sheet pan is 13"x9". That means you can't fit one half sheet pan on a rack and you can't fit two quarter sheet pans on a rack, only one quarter sheet pan with leftover space. The same thing goes for almost all the disposable aluminum pans you buy as those are typically sized the same way. That means you have to cook directly on wire racks to optimized available space and that means a lot more mess and cleanup. I have a pretty ridiculous cooking setup at home and none of my dozens of pans fit optimally in this smoker. As far as functionality goes this product does a great job. It's simple to assemble, easy to use, and does a great job of smoking with minimal effort and great results. It does scratch easily on the outside though, so beware of that. It's light enough to pick up and carry inside and outside, which I have to do because I live in an isolated mountain area of WNC and can't leave it outside due to bears. Item arrived dented in one corner but still fully functional so it didn't bother me enough to go through the return process since you have to cut the shipping box apart to get it out. There's no taping that back together for return shipping! I did not take the star off for the damage, I took it off for the poor decision in internal sizing. If they want a five start product then it needs to be designed for industry-standard pan sizes internally just like every oven, in my opinion.

Notable Improvement Over Competition
I've had the East Oak 30" smoker for a little less than a month now, and have used it five or so times already, with a good bit of food in it each time. I'm currently waiting for three pork shoulders to reach temperature. After having three different MasterBuilt smokers, and having to replace multiple parts on each of them, I owed it to myself to give another setup a chance. And (so far) I'm really glad that I did. I went with the solid front, black, 30" electric smoker. I feel like it's as if someone took a MasterBuilt smoker, identified the common failure and annoyance points, corrected them, and improved on the whole thing. The wood chip loading is extremely simple and convenient. There's a very sturdy drawer on the side that pulls straight out, no need to twist or anything. And instead of holding a palm full of chips, it holds probably two cups. They aren't kidding, a full drawer of chips will get you 3-4 hours of smoking, where I was getting about 45 minutes with past smokers. The drip tray is conveniently "disguised," front and center of the unit. There's no awkward drip collector hanging off the back. It's another very simple pull out drawer, easy to access, and actually makes sense. No fumbling around the back to clean up after you're done. The water pan in this thing is so much better designed, and easier to work with. It's a simple square pan that has drippings channeled into it by another tray. There's no awkward balancing of an oddly designed contraption. Just grab it when you're done, empty, and clean. The control panel is in a nice spot too. Easy to read, easy to access. Past smokers I've had always had a weird angle to the panel, it would catch glare in the sun, and I would have to hunch over and cover it to be able to see. I don't know if it's the design, or what, but this one is so much easier to see and operate. I had problems with past smokers operating in colder weather. Anything below about 30โฐ and it just didn't want to turn on. The East Oak smoker made us some beautiful chickens a few weeks ago, in single digit weather. There's only really two things that I can complain about. The smoke exit vent doesn't close as much as I would have liked it to. It is so much easier to adjust than prior smokers. It's got a nice knob on it, and glides easily into place. But I do like to basically close it completely for maximum time the smoke is in the box. It closes about 2/3 of the vent, it's be nice if it was capable of closing all the way. And... aswith any electric smoker... temperature maintenance. It is, however, a MUCH tighter temperature range than prior smokers. In the past, I would see pretty big swings from actual vs set temperature. Sometimes greater than 100โฐ. The East Oak smoker seems to keep the bok temperature within about 20โฐ-25โฐ. Which is about as close as one can expect with an electric smoker... I've been setting it at about 10โฐ below what I want to smoke at, and everything has turned out great. End of the day, I'm not a competitive BBQ enthusiast.
